An intro to the first two steps of the 'design thinking' process: developing empathy & framing the problem/opportunity.
Master key concepts and practical skills through structured learning modules. By completing this curriculum, you'll gain valuable expertise applicable to real-world scenarios.
Discover and understand how to apply the first few steps of the design process to your new venture.
Improve your ability to think more like a designer (open to opportunities) rather than as a manager focused on constraints.
Strengthen your empathy, meaning your ability to better understand people and their needs.
